Image Caption:
S48-109-043: Weird shaped island "walking dog"
This color Infrared View of the Falkland Islands (52.0S, 58.5W) was taken with a dual camera mount. Compare this scene with STS048-82-042 for an analysis of the unique properties of each film type. Comparative tests aids in determining the kinds of information unique to each system and evaluates and compares photography taken through hazy atmospheres. Infrared film is best at penetrating haze, vegetation detection and producing a sharp image.
